WSBK - Yamaha Wins At Nurburgring
Posted: Sun Jun 15, 2008 11:51 pm
by djalbin
Exciting racing with WSBK Superbikes at Nurburgring. Noriyuki Haga, who has six pins and a plate in his broken collarbone, won race one and race two. Nori's teammate, Troy Corser, finished second in race two.
